Output 858c207469f32f42ce78b43f205a1b37062731f21e23d2906b0f30f6d9fa29fb:6

value
593309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f85f08cb55db277e14b764793cb0911c6d7fa6a OP_EQUAL
address
3LcJFYR9V71LKFzgbpjyGChdTrk3Uo14M6
transaction
858c207469f32f42ce78b43f205a1b37062731f21e23d2906b0f30f6d9fa29fb
confirmations
423778
spent
true